Im not seeing this on the message boards so ill drop it in, but maybe its already on the SDS radar.
McGunski has a youtube video detailing how any pitcher with 99 control on a sinker or change up can consistently put a pitch low and in, placed where it is impossible to get under the ball due to PCI limitations. The batter is doomed to ground balls, and if you use the shift, doomed to ground outs more than 90% of the time.
The PCI does not reach the 4 corners of the strike zone, so perfectly placed downward breaking pitches (and pinpoint allows consistent perfect placement) is a meta that will quickly break online play....as this knowledge spreads.
SDS has information i do not, so im not sure what the quickest, most effective fix is, but it is an issue that must be addressed asap.

2. Increase PCI size on HOF and legend-Not the worst option, but I'm not sure its the best solution eitherIt's not a cut and dry issue for sure. I think it was meant to curb good contact on pitches just off those areas but with how the PCI works you're not at a disadvantage except low and in. Late timing usually puts the ball in the air, so anything up or away you can get around.
If they expand the PCI range all the way to the corners, good pitches just of the corners will start getting squared up. I don't think anyone wants that, because those good pitches will end up right in the PCI smash zone.
If they would just reduce contact ability and exit velocity on pitches outside of the zone, the game would be more consistent. I mean sure guys can go out of the zone and square stuff up, but statistically speaking it's far from the norm.
